    I've been reading with interest the tyre threads for 599.

    Is MPSS still the advised choice in 2020?

    I'm running those now, but finding unless the road is bone dry they're a bit of a handful.

    I don't deliberately venture out in the wet, but sometimes you get caught out and even on dry days, stretches of road can linger wet for a a few days.

    So, stick with MPSS or try something new?

    (I don't use the car enough in winter to warrant a winter tyre)

    The Pilot Sport 4S is the replacement for the MPSS. They are still manufacturing some MPSS sizes, but eventually they will be phased out. I replaced my MPSS tires with the PS4S when they old ones timed out.
